Milford, Michigan: Small-Town Charm with Modern Dating Needs

Located in Oakland County, Milford is one of Michigan's most picturesque villages. Known for its historic downtown district, scenic parks, community events, and proximity to Kensington Metropark, Milford offers residents a balance of small-town warmth and suburban convenience.

The village attracts young professionals, families, entrepreneurs, retirees, and individuals looking for a close-knit community atmosphere. Local festivals, outdoor recreation opportunities, coffee shops, and community gatherings create environments where social connections naturally develop.

Herpes Is More Common Than Most People Realize

Despite ongoing stigma, herpes remains one of the most prevalent viral infections worldwide. According to the World Health Organization (WHO), approximately 3.8 billion people under the age of 50 are living with HSV-1 infections globally, while more than 500 million people have HSV-2.

Within the United States, the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) estimates that nearly one in six adults between the ages of 14 and 49 has genital herpes.

These statistics demonstrate that herpes affects people from every educational background, profession, race, and socioeconomic group. Nevertheless, many HSV-positive individuals experience:

  • Fear of rejection from potential partners.
  • Anxiety about disclosure conversations.
  • Concerns regarding confidentiality and privacy.
  • Reduced confidence after diagnosis.
  • Feelings of loneliness and social isolation.

Supportive herpes dating communities can help alleviate these concerns while empowering individuals to pursue healthy relationships.
